Role Summary
We are looking for a Cost Manager with proven experience to join our Cost Management Team within the Wales & West Region Project Controls Practice. You must be ambitious, innovative, and able to work across the Energy and Infrastructure sectors. The role involves supporting senior cost managers, delivering the business plan for the rapidly expanding team, ensuring our cost‑management services meet the highest standards, and fostering a collaborative, professional, and positive working environment.
Responsibilities
- Reporting into the Cost Management Lead, you will support the building of long‑term, sustainable relationships with members of our organisation and our wider client base.
- Provide technical experience in Cost Management services across complex infrastructure.
- Demonstrate an understanding of industry benchmarks and best practices, Cost and Work Breakdown Structures, and methods of measurement (e.g. RMM, NRM).
- Develop a growing network within the energy and/or infrastructure sectors.
- Apply innovation, technical excellence, and exceptional service delivery to cost‑management activities.
- Monitor, analyse, and control cost performance against set targets.
- Identify and apply cost‑efficient solutions.
-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ams.
- Remain aware of challenges and opportunities in the industry.
- Possess commercial, quantity surveying, or finance skills, with working knowledge of the construction industry, and an understanding of Standard Forms of Contract (NEC/FIDIC/IChemE).
- Understand performance measurement of projects using Earned Value Management (EVM) and similar techniques.
- Apply cost analysis techniques.
- Experience or desire to use VBA is desirable but not essential.
- Major project or programme work experience is desirable.
